Technology giant, Google, has announced that it will build its first product development centre in Africa in Kenya’s capital, Nairobi.

In 2018, the Company announced a one billion-dollar investment plan for Africa to capitalize on the growing number of internet users on the continent.

Managing Director for Google in Africa, Nitin Gajria, said by 2030, Africa will have 800 million internet users and thus Google is committed to accelerating Africa’s digital transformation through enabling human capital.

He said earlier this year, payments technology firm Visa and computer software giant Microsoft, also opened innovation hubs in Nairobi.

The centres will see job opportunities for software engineers, researchers and designers.
